Specifications

  1. Net Quantity: 2 N
  2. Material: Bronze / Kansa · 78–80% Copper, 20–22% Tin (78:22)
  3. Method & finish: Hand-beaten · charcoal exterior
  4. Katori (2 N): 9.80 × 9.80 × 3.50 cm · 0.140 kg (each)
  5. Note: Any variation in weight & size is the characteristic of a hand-beaten piece.
  6. Manufactured & marketed by: Kansawala Mukundray Fulchand, Kansara Bazar Road, Opp Bhuta Vadi, Sihor, Bhavnagar, Gujarat – 364240
  7. Country Of Origin: India

How to live with it

  • Wash like any vessel — a normal scrubber and dish soap.
  • After washing, dry it with a normal cloth.
  • Serve, don't store. A wash brings back the shine.
  • The charcoal exterior smooths and settles the more you use it.
  • In the monsoon, a little colour change is normal.
  • Looked after simply, it serves for decades.

Where the metal begins

Most who sell it, buy it. We make it - the whole difference.

Pure Copper And Tin, Weighed By Hand

Every batch starts as 78 parts copper to 22 parts tin, weighed by hand at our own furnace. Most sellers buy metal already mixed elsewhere; we measure ours ourselves, so we know exactly what's in it.

Shaped By Hand Or Mould

Hand-beaten pieces are shaped cold, blow by blow under the hammer, so each one is lighter, tougher, and a little different from the next. Cast pieces are poured molten into a mould, giving a heavier, uniform piece every time. Most sellers carry only one of these; we make and stock both, in every size.

Polished Where You Eat, Untouched Where You See

The inside is buffed to a smooth, food-safe surface, ready to serve from. The outside is left exactly as the fire made it, a natural dark tone that no imitation metal can fake, so you can see the purity, not just be told about it.

Tested In Real Lab

Before it leaves our workshop, every batch is checked at an NABL-accredited lab for its 78:22 purity and food safety. Most sellers just state a ratio. We hand you the lab report.

Shipped Directly From Sihor

Every piece is inspected by hand, packed, and dispatched the same day from our workshop in Sihor, Gujarat, straight to you, with no distributor or middleman in between.
